You may do so in any reasonable manner, but not in any way that suggests the licensor endorses you or your use.<span id="by-more-container"></span></p> </li> <li class="license sa"> <p><strong>ShareAlike</strong> — If you remix, transform, or build upon the material, you must distribute your contributions under the <a id="same_license_popup" class="helpLink" tabindex="0" title="" href="https://creativecommons.org/licenses/by-sa/4.0/" data-original-title="">same license</a> as the original.</p> </li> </ul> nurasjournal@gmail.com (Mr. Safnowandi) nurasjournal@gmail.com (Mr. Pahmi Husain) Thu, 01 Jan 2026 00:00:00 +0700 OJS 3.3.0.7 http://blogs.law.harvard.edu/tech/rss 60 Pengabdian kepada Masyarakat melalui Digitalisasi dalam Meningkatkan UMKM di Desa Suka Makmur Kabupaten Langkat https://e-journal.lp3kamandanu.com/index.php/nuras/article/view/775 <p><em>This community service activity was conducted by the Community Service Program (KKN) team in Suka Makmur Village, Langkat Regency. The activity aimed to improve the digital literacy of Micro, Small, and Medium Enterprises (MSMEs) who are still limited in utilizing digital technology. This effort was carried out through training on "E-Commerce Development and MSME Registration on Google Maps." The methods used included field observation, interviews with MSMEs, and documentation of the activity. Data analysis was conducted descriptively to describe the implementation process, results, and impact on improving participants' digital skills. The results showed an increase in participants' understanding of registering their businesses on Google Maps, understanding the benefits of QRIS as a digital payment tool, and using social media for business promotion. Of the target 15 MSMEs, 6 successfully created active and verified Google Maps accounts. The main obstacles faced were limited internet access and digital devices. This activity uses a qualitative descriptive method involving three stages: 1) initial observation and assessment; 2) intervention (implementation of QRIS at Apotik Kasih Ibu and development of brand identity strengthening strategies at Herawati Cake); and 3) final evaluation through interviews and documentation. The results of the activity show a measurable impact of the intervention, where the implementation of QRIS at Apotik Kasih Ibu increases the efficiency of cashier transaction times by an average of 30%, and increases customer convenience. The branding strategy at Herawati Cake has succeeded in strengthening the business image as shown by a 45% increase in social media engagement and expansion of market reach outside the sub-district. These two interventions support SDG 8 and SDG 9. The synergy between digitalization and branding has proven effective as a model for accelerating modern and sustainable village economic development, and has the potential to be replicated as a best practice for strengthening the community-based digital economy.</em></p> Faris Andrawika Harahap, Ahmad Yusuf Akbar, Zuhrinal M Nawawi, Tuti Anggraini Copyright (c) 2026 Faris Andrawika Harahap, Ahmad Yusuf Akbar, Zuhrinal M Nawawi, & Tuti Anggraini https://creativecommons.org/licenses/by-sa/4.0/ https://e-journal.lp3kamandanu.com/index.php/nuras/article/view/804 Thu, 01 Jan 2026 00:00:00 +0700 Workshop Pembelajaran Deep Learning dalam Meningkatkan Kualitas Pendidikan Sekolah Dasar di SD Negeri 3 Sandubaya https://e-journal.lp3kamandanu.com/index.php/nuras/article/view/798 <p><em>This workshop on deep learning- based instruction aimed to enhance the quality of education by improving teacher’s ability to understand and implement deep learning approaches in the classroom. The lack of public knowledge about how to utilize and process natural ingredients to produce quality herbal medicine is a major obstacle that requires educational intervention. This community service activity aims to increase the knowledge of village health cadres about the use and processing of safe and quality herbal medicine. The activity was carried out in Sumbersuko Village, Wagir District, Malang Regency on August 29, 2025, participants consisted of 15 village health cadres. Evaluation of the activity was carried out with a pre-test and post-test. The pre-test results showed a general understanding of herbal medicine, the category of good at 7%, sufficient 13%, and less than 80%. The benefits of herbal medicine for disease prevention, the category of good at 13%, sufficient 20%, and less than 67%. The process of making and safety of herbal medicine, the category of good at 13%, sufficient 27%, and less than 60%. After socialization, the results of the post-test showed a general understanding of herbal medicine in the category of good at 47%, sufficient 7%, and less than 47%. The benefits of herbal medicine for disease prevention were categorized as good at 67%, sufficient at 13%, and insufficient at 20%. The manufacturing process and safety of herbal medicine were categorized as good at 67%, sufficient at 7%, and insufficient at 27%. Thus, a structured outreach program has proven effective in increasing the knowledge of health cadres and has the potential to support the strengthening of the role of herbal medicine as a health alternative based on local wisdom.</em></p> Rudy Mardianto, Agung Permata, Misgiati Misgiati Copyright (c) 2026 Rudy Mardianto, Agung Permata, & Misgiati https://creativecommons.org/licenses/by-sa/4.0/ https://e-journal.lp3kamandanu.com/index.php/nuras/article/view/923 Fri, 02 Jan 2026 00:00:00 +0700 Edukasi dan Pelatihan Pengelolaan Keuangan UMKM dan Organisasi melalui Implementasi Buku Kas Sederhana di Dusun Gandari, Lombok Barat https://e-journal.lp3kamandanu.com/index.php/nuras/article/view/928 <p><em>This community service program was carried out in Gandari Hamlet, Narmada Village, Narmada District, West Lombok Regency, West Nusa Tenggara Province, with the aim of improving financial literacy and financial management skills of micro business actors and local organizations through the implementation of a simple cash book system. This activity was carried out online with 29 participants from the Faculty of Science, Engineering, and Applied Sciences, Mandalika University of Education. This community service method adopted a practice-based training approach. The training involved two main sessions, namely a theory session and a practice session. In the theory session, participants were given an understanding of the importance of scientific writing in accordance with academic standards and how to use Mendeley in reference management. The practice session focused on teaching the use of Mendeley directly, from installing the application to managing references and inserting automatic citations in documents. Evaluation was carried out through pre-tests and post-tests to measure the improvement of participants' skills. The evaluation results showed a significant improvement in participants' skills.</em> <em>Before the training, only 30% of participants were able to operate Mendeley properly, but after the training, 92% showed significant improvement. The training also accelerated the process of compiling a reference list, from 3-4 hours to just 15-30 minutes. This training is expected to improve the quality of scientific writing among student teachers and prepare them to produce more structured, efficient, and academically compliant scientific work.</em></p> Ade Kurniawan, Sanapiah Sanapiah, Syahrir Syahrir, Masjudin Masjudin, Reny Amalia Permata, Zainal Abidin Copyright (c) 2026 Ade Kurniawan, Sanapiah, Syahrir, Masjudin, Reny Amalia Permata, & Zainal Abidin https://creativecommons.org/licenses/by-sa/4.0/ https://e-journal.lp3kamandanu.com/index.php/nuras/article/view/855 Fri, 09 Jan 2026 00:00:00 +0700 Pelatihan Pemanfaatan ChatGPT dan Scite.ai untuk Meningkatkan Kualitas Penulisan Artikel Pengabdian https://e-journal.lp3kamandanu.com/index.php/nuras/article/view/614 <p><em>This community service activity aims to improve the competence of lecturers at the Faculty of Culture, Management, and Business, Mandalika University of Education, in writing quality community service articles through the use of artificial intelligence technology, specifically ChatGPT and Scite.ai. This Community Service-Oriented (PkM) research aims to: 1) identify the level of knowledge, attitudes, and commitment in Dusun Ngargosoko Wetan concerning smoking hazards before and after the implementation of a cigarette smoke-free home PkM program; and 2) investigate how the initiative can enhance family health, fortify socio-religious cohesion, and alleviate economic burdens in low-income households. This community service-oriented research utilized a defined Participatory Action Research (PAR) cycle (planning → action → reflection → revision) to collaboratively create and implement a full-day intervention for 40 intentionally selected residents (25 adult men, predominantly fathers/young adults, 15 adolescents). The majority of participating homes had children and reported low to moderate incomes. Pre/post questionnaires assessed knowledge, attitudes, and household regulations; enabled small-group conversations incorporating socio-religious messages and generated family commitments. Quantitative analyses (SPSS v26; R v4.2) employed paired t-tests for continuous variables. A community-led three-month follow-up was scheduled to evaluate enduring change. The results indicate that the average knowledge improved from 62.5 to 81.3, reflecting a 30% relative improvement (paired t-test, p &lt; .01). Post-event commitments: 65% embraced smoke-free household promises, 25% aimed to decrease smoking, 10% remained unchanged. The implementation of PAR cycles and socio-religious framing yielded immediate, substantial benefits and created local monitoring systems to facilitate long-term sustainability and policy adoption.</p> Ahmad Syauqi Hidayatullah, Anselmus Sudirman, Johanes Climacus Setyo Karjono, Sulistyo Budiarto, Petrus Piro Bani, Lita Indah Sari, Maria Advenia Wango Copyright (c) 2026 Ahmad Syauqi Hidayatullah, Anselmus Sudirman, Johanes Climacus Setyo Karjono, Sulistyo Budiarto, Petrus Piro Bani, Lita Indah Sari, & Maria Advenia Wango https://creativecommons.org/licenses/by-sa/4.0/ https://e-journal.lp3kamandanu.com/index.php/nuras/article/view/939 Thu, 15 Jan 2026 00:00:00 +0700 Menciptakan Rasa Peduli dan Kesadaran Lingkungan melalui Gerakan Bersih Bersama Mahasiswa dan Masyarakat di Kampus https://e-journal.lp3kamandanu.com/index.php/nuras/article/view/1016 <p><em>The clean-up movement, involving students and the campus community, is a crucial effort to foster environmental awareness and concern at Sunan Giri University, Surabaya.
